Under tight supervision from the Ministry, the industry underwent a phenomenal expansion, from less than 4,000 workers in January 1933 to almost 54,000 two years later. At the same time the Air Ministry issued design contracts for an entire new generation of aircraft and aero-engines.
The Wages of Destruction: The Making and Breaking of the Nazi Economy
